Created by: Janine Graves on 11-02-2009 05:20:53 PM Is the Call Data variable 'UUI' in Call Studio ever populated? I have a customer in class who says they use this field a lot on their Avaya system, and they're starting to integrate with Cisco CVP, so he needs to pass this information into Studio. Similarly he uses this data for screen pop - so is there a way to send UUI from a Studio app for a telephony transfer? I looked in the CVP Self Service Bootstrap vxml doc for both stand alone and comprehensive environments, and I see ani and dnis being passed into the studio app, but I DON'T see UUI. Thanks, Janine

Subject: RE: UUI in CVP Studio Replied by: Paul Tindall on 28-10-2011 06:31:27 PM As far as I'm aware the UUI parameter is just a redundant legacy item that unfortunately wasn't implemented. The TCL / VoiceXML bootstrap files would have to be modified to extract UUS from incoming GTD and pass it to the VoiceXML server via the URL params list. It's a bit inconvenient but the advantage of picking up UUI using a custom element is that you stay supported by not modifying any of the standard files.
